Remarks At first I came home and told my boyfriend about the HUGE shooting star I saw go across the sky right in front of me while I was driving down the highway. But then when I started to look up online to see if perhaps anybody else saw it or had footage of it i began to think maybe i had actually seen a fireball. It wasnt like the enormous green fireball i saw last year but it was the biggest shooting star I'd ever seen besides the green fireball i saw last year!! It went about half of its path in the sky and then burst a bit, not huge burst, and then the second half of its trip across the skye was even brighter than the first but continued to travel in a singular streak like it had before the burst.
